Small and efficient laser driver platform released

30-05-2025 | Silanna Semiconductor | Semiconductors

Silanna Semiconductor has launched the FirePower series of laser driver ICs, which greatly reduces the size and increases the peak power of LiDAR applications.

These ICs are the first to combine charging and firing on a single chip. This allows for a considerable reduction in size and losses, as well as the removal of several components from the PCB, thereby reducing the component count and BOM cost.

The integration also enables the development of high-performance laser-based applications that deliver unmatched pulse power and precision. For example, using the IC allows a 400W quad EEL (Edge-Emitting Laser) module to shrink from 400mm2 to 80mm2 (an 80% improvement) while enabling a 73% improvement in VIN-to-laser efficiency.

The first product to be launched in the FirePower family is the SL2001, a 14-pin 3.5mm2 IC with a sub-2ns FWHM laser pulse and dual drive for peak-power outputs up to 1000W.

The device has high charging efficiency and operates from a supply range of 3V to 24V to fire either EEL diodes or VCSELs (Vertical Cavity Surface Emitting Laser) with a pulse repetition frequency of over 10MHz.

The device also has a differential Laser Fire output indication with a sub-0.1ns Peak-to-Peak jitter. Built-in laser output power sensing and control allows it to meet eye-safety requirements. The device also uniquely implements programmability via an I2C interface and multi-time-programmable ROM, removing the necessity for an on-PCB MCU. The device can track and respond to input voltage and resonant capacitor voltage.

The IC is targeted at LiDAR and other ToF sensing systems used in industrial manufacturing and automotive systems.

Product marketing director Ken Boyden said: "LiDAR and similar laser-based applications have traditionally relied on third-party power supply regulators to meet the high voltage requirements of resonant pulsed laser systems. The FirePower family is the first to consolidate both highly efficient high-voltage charging and high-power firing on a single chip. As the first product in the FirePower family, the SL2001 sets new benchmarks for performance and efficiency while reducing component count and BOM cost."

Stingray is available in a 1 x 3.5mm WLCSP Package and is obtainable immediately as an evaluation kit or in sample quantities.
